Shelter Dog #1

A couple of things came together in inspiring me to paint this one. First off, I really loved painting the portraits of my friend's and family's dogs that I did as gifts for last Christmas.
Secondly, I was hugely inspired by the artist Karin Jurick, who did an entire series of mugshots she got from the internet. So I combined the two ideas to do a series on shelter dogs. You know, those incredibly sad portraits of dogs who need a home whose photos are on the websites of your local animal shelter. After doing paintings of clearly happy dogs, it was instantly clear that these dogs were not happy at all. It's a real challenge to catch their expression and try to convey something more than that this is a certain breed of dog. Hopefully it won't be too much of a downer.
